Carnell Warren is a big-bodied, four-star wide receiver who presents a significant mismatch for defensive backs on the perimeter. His combination of a large frame, basketball background, and impressive body control makes him a dominant threat on contested catches and in the red zone.

Physical Profile

Stands at a legitimate 6-foot-4 and weighs in the 195-208 pound range, giving him a 'hulking' frame for the wide receiver position. Warren possesses plus athleticism for his size, highlighted by superior bounce and body control that is evident from his basketball background where he averaged over 13 points per game. This physical profile gives him a massive catch radius and the ability to consistently play above the rim.

Play Style

Warren plays a physical, above-the-rim style of football. He thrives on the perimeter where quarterbacks can give him opportunities to win one-on-one matchups. On film, he is a go-to target in key situations, particularly in the red zone, demonstrating strong hands and the ability to play through traffic and secure difficult catches. His background as a multi-sport athlete is apparent in his coordination and competitive nature on the field.

Strengths

  • Excels in 50-50 situations, using his 6-foot-4 frame, impressive leaping ability, and body control to high-point the football over defenders for contested catches.
  • Dominant red zone threat, consistently translating his size and ball skills into touchdowns, as evidenced by his 14 scores during his junior season.
  • More than just a jump-ball specialist, he shows the ability to make dynamic lateral cuts and create yards after the catch on screens and in-breaking routes.
  • Highly productive on the field, with back-to-back productive seasons, including 59 receptions for 846 yards and 14 touchdowns as a junior.

College Projection

As a four-star prospect who is already physically developed, Warren should be viewed as a potential difference-maker at the Power Four level. He projects as an outside 'X' receiver who can become a primary red-zone target early in his career. With continued development in route running, he has the upside to become a multi-year starter and a focal point of a passing offense.

NFL Outlook

Given his four-star rating, verified size, and exceptional ball-winning skills, Carnell Warren possesses the foundational traits that NFL teams covet in an outside receiver. If he continues to develop and translates his high school production to the college level at North Carolina, he has the potential to be a future NFL Draft selection.
